Error description
You are using IBM Rational System Architect 11.4.2 and you are making your SvcV-1 (Services View 1 Service Context Diagram), you tried copying over a bunch of symbols from your SV-1, including Performer (DM2) and System (DM2) symbols. The Performers copied over fine, but the Systems did not. They copy over as Description (DM2) symbols instead of System (DM2). Workarounds: Drag on System definitions from the Explorer or Draw Systems using Performer symbol on the SV-1.

Problem summary
**************************************************************** * USERS AFFECTED: * **************************************************************** * PROBLEM DESCRIPTION: * **************************************************************** * RECOMMENDATION: * **************************************************************** Any symbol not of a type supported by the target diagram is replaced with a rectangle. The 'Transform Symbol' symbol context menu is then made available, but this does not support transformation to the symbol types on this diagram.
Problem conclusion
The underlying definition type is now checked and the first symbol type found that represents the same definition type is used to replace it.
